Output 3c29f0d76fa4cd020a9fb2e365badf4f7d0949b3f5d5d4d8c0afd934816664cf:3

value
25102954
script pubkey
OP_0 OP_PUSHBYTES_20 f8229b6afc22508e15a28cde95cd32f230453d95
address
bc1qlq3fk6huyfggu9dz3n0ftnfj7gcy20v4as57uv
transaction
3c29f0d76fa4cd020a9fb2e365badf4f7d0949b3f5d5d4d8c0afd934816664cf
confirmations
242867
spent
true